■ Error messages 
“ERROR”: This indicates a problem eit her in the CD or inside the player.  
“CD CHECK”: The CD may be dirty, damaged or inserted up-side down.
“WAIT”: Operation has stopped due to a high temperature inside the 
player. Wait for a while and then press  . If the CD still 
cannot be played back, contact any authorized Toyota dealer 
or repairer, or another duly qualified and equipped profes-
sional. 
■ Discs that can be used 
Discs with the marks shown below can be used. 
Playback may not be possible depending on recording format or disc fea-
tures, or due to scratches, dirt or deterioration. 
CDs with copy-protect features may not be used. 
■ CD player protection feature 
To protect the internal components, playback is automatically stopped when 
a problem is detected while the CD player is being used. 
■ If a CD is left inside the CD player or in the ejected position for 
extended periods 
The CD may be damaged and may not play properly. 
■ Lens cleaners 
Do not use lens cleaners. Doing so may damage the CD player.

● Compatible disc formats 
The following disc formats can be used. 
• Disc formats: CD-ROM Mode 1 and Mode 2 
CD-ROM XA Mode 2, Form 1 and Form 2
• File formats: ISO9660 Level 1, Level 2, (Romeo, Joliet)
MP3 and WMA files written in any format other than those listed above
may not play correctly, and their file names and folder names may not
be displayed correctly.
Items related to standards and limitations are as follows. 
• Maximum directory hierarchy: 8 levels 
• Maximum length of folder names/file names: 32 characters
• Maximum number of folders: 192 (including the root)
• Maximum number of files per disc: 255 
● File names 
The only files that can be recognized as MP3/WMA and played are those 
with the extension .mp3 or .wma. 
● Multi-sessions 
As the audio system is compatible with multi-sessions, it is possible to play 
discs that contain MP3 and WMA files. However, only the first session can
be played. 
● ID3 and WMA tags 
ID3 tags can be added to MP3 files, making it possible to record the track 
title and artist name, etc. 
The system is compatible with ID3 Ver. 1.0, 1.1, and Ver. 2.2, 2.3 ID3 tags. 
(The number of characters is based on ID3 Ver. 1.0 and 1.1.)  
WMA tags can be added to WMA files, making it possible to record the 
track title and artist name in the same way as with ID3 tags. 
● MP3 and WMA playback 
When a disc containing MP3 or WMA files is inserted, all files on the disc 
are first checked. Once the file check is finished, the first MP3 or WMA file
is played. To make the file check finish more quickly, we recommend you
do not write in any files other than MP3 or WMA files or create any unnec-
essary folders. 
If the discs contain a mixture of music data and MP3 or WMA format data, 
only music data can be played.
